想在3天内快速部署发卡平台?只需5个关键步骤: ,1. **环境准备**:选择稳定服务器(推荐云服务商如阿里云、腾讯云),安装宝塔面板或Docker,配置PHP+MySQL环境,确保基础运行条件。 ,2. **一键部署源码**:使用成熟发卡系统(如发卡网、独角数卡),通过宝塔或SSH上传源码,自动解压后完成目录权限配置,10分钟搭建核心框架。 ,3. **支付接口对接**:接入支付宝、微信支付或免签通道,修改商户ID和密钥,测试支付回调,确保交易流畅无阻。 ,4. **商品与模板配置**:后台添加虚拟商品(卡密/激活码),设置分类与定价;选用响应式模板,优化移动端显示,提升用户体验。 ,5. **安全与上线**:部署SSL证书、防火墙,关闭调试模式,进行压力测试后解析域名,正式上线! ,全程注重效率与稳定性,配合详细教程,新手也能轻松完成极速部署。(字数:198)
在当今数字化支付时代,发卡平台已成为电商、会员制服务和各类订阅业务的基础设施,对于运营团队而言,能否快速部署上线一个稳定可靠的发卡平台,直接关系到业务启动速度和用户体验,本文将分享一套经过实战验证的快速部署方法论,帮助你在3天内完成从零到上线的全过程。

发卡平台的核心价值与部署挑战
发卡平台本质上是一个虚拟卡号生成与管理系统,它能够:
- 即时生成可用于在线支付的虚拟卡号
- 灵活设置单次或多次使用限额
- 与现有支付系统无缝集成
- 提供完善的交易监控和报表功能
部署过程中的典型痛点包括:
- 技术选型困难:开源方案功能不全,商业方案成本高昂
- 合规门槛高:PCI DSS等支付行业合规要求复杂
- 对接周期长:与银行或支付网关的API对接耗时
- 风控配置复杂:防欺诈规则需要专业经验
5步极速部署框架(附具体实施细节)
第一步:基础设施准备(Day 1上午)
推荐技术栈组合:
- 容器化部署:Docker + Kubernetes(弹性扩展必备)
- 数据库:PostgreSQL(事务处理) + Redis(高速缓存)
- 前端:Vue.js + Element UI(快速构建管理后台)
关键配置技巧:
# 示例:使用Docker Compose快速启动服务 version: '3' services: card-service: image: card-platform:v2.1 ports: - "8080:8080" environment: - DB_URL=postgresql://user:pass@db:5432/cards db: image: postgres:13 volumes: - pg_data:/var/lib/postgresql/data
第二步:支付通道对接(Day 1下午)
快速对接策略:
- 优先选择提供沙箱环境的支付网关(如Stripe、Adyen)
- 使用标准化协议:优先选择支持RESTful API的供应商
- 并行测试多个通道:降低单点故障风险
API调用示例:
// 虚拟卡创建请求示例 const response = await fetch('https://api.payment-gateway.com/v1/cards', { method: 'POST', headers: { 'Authorization': 'Bearer YOUR_API_KEY', 'Content-Type': 'application/json' }, body: JSON.stringify({ amount: 100.00, currency: 'USD', expiry_month: 12, expiry_year: 2025 }) });
第三步:风控系统配置(Day 2上午)
必须实现的防护规则:
- 实时交易监控:单笔/日累计限额
- 地理围栏:限制特定国家/地区的使用
- 商户类别码(MCC)过滤:禁止高风险行业交易
- 行为分析:检测异常消费模式
风控规则配置表示例: | 规则类型 | 参数设置 | 触发动作 | |---------|---------|---------| | 单笔限额 | >$500 | 拦截并通知 | | 频次控制 | 5笔/分钟 | 暂时冻结 | | 地域限制 | 高风险国家 | 自动拒绝 |
第四步:运营后台搭建(Day 2下午)
必备功能模块:
- 卡生命周期管理:发卡、冻结、注销
- 资金流水监控:实时交易看板
- 客户自助服务:余额查询、交易明细
- 批量操作工具:CSV导入导出
UI设计建议:
- 采用卡片式布局展示关键指标
- 设置多条件组合查询
- 操作日志完整记录(满足审计要求)
第五步:测试与上线(Day 3)
标准化检查清单:
- [ ] 支付通道测试:成功/失败/退款场景
- [ ] 负载测试:模拟1000并发请求
- [ ] 安全扫描:OWASP Top 10漏洞检查
- [ ] 合规审查:PCI DSS自评估问卷
灰度发布策略:
- 先开放内部测试账户(10%流量)
- 逐步扩大至种子用户(30%)
- 全量上线前进行最终压力测试
避坑指南:我们踩过的那些雷
真实案例教训:
-
缓存雪崩:某次促销活动期间,Redis未设置过期时间分散,导致数据库瞬间过载
解决方案:采用缓存分级策略 + 熔断机制
-
日期格式问题:与境外支付网关对接时,日期解析失败造成批量交易失败
最佳实践:所有API交互强制使用ISO 8601格式
-
余额不同步:分布式环境下出现超额消费
技术方案:引入分布式锁(Redlock算法)
进阶优化方向
上线后持续改进的3个重点:
-
性能优化:
- 数据库分库分表(按卡BIN号路由)
- 热点账户特殊处理(单独队列)
-
智能风控升级:
- 引入机器学习模型识别欺诈模式
- 建立用户行为基线(正常消费画像)
-
生态扩展:
- 开放API供合作伙伴集成
- 开发移动端SDK(APP内快速发卡)
速度与质量的平衡艺术
快速部署不是以牺牲稳定性为代价,文中方案的核心在于:
- 合理利用成熟组件减少重复造轮子
- 标准化流程避免决策瘫痪
- 自动化工具链提升效率
建议团队在首次部署后,每季度进行一次架构评审,持续优化系统性能,发卡平台的成功不仅在于技术实现,更在于是否真正解决了业务痛点——让资金流动更安全、更便捷。
下一步行动建议:
- 根据业务规模选择适合的部署方案(中小企业可考虑云服务托管版)
- 提前准备合规材料(特别是反洗钱相关文件)
- 建立多环境部署流程(开发/测试/生产严格隔离)
通过这套方法论,我们已帮助多家企业将发卡平台部署周期从传统的一个月压缩到3天内完成,轮到你的团队实现效率跃升了!
本文链接:https://www.ncwmj.com/news/151.html